// }}}
// {{{ function _mail_subj
-
+
protected function _mail_subj()
{
return "[Polytechnique.org] Récupération de {$this->m_prenom} {$this->m_nom} ({$this->m_promo})";
global $globals;
$email = $this->m_bestalias . '@' . $globals->mail->domain;
- XDB::execute("UPDATE emails AS e
+ XDB::execute("UPDATE emails AS e
INNER JOIN aliases AS a ON (a.id = e.uid)
SET e.flags = 'active'
WHERE a.alias = {?} AND e.email = {?}", $this->m_forlife, $this->m_email);
if (XDB::affectedRows() > 0) {
$this->m_reactive = true;
$mailer = new PlMailer();
- $mailer->setFrom('"Association Polytechnique.org" <register@' . $globals->mails->domain . '>');
+ $mailer->setFrom('"Association Polytechnique.org" <register@' . $globals->mail->domain . '>');
$mailer->addTo($email);
$mailer->setSubject("Mise à jour de ton adresse $email");
$mailer->setTxtBody(wordwrap("Cher Camarade,\n\n"
$mailer->send();
return true;
}
-
+
$email = $this->m_bestalias . '@' . $globals->mail->domain;
if ($this->old_email) {
$subject = "Ton adresse $email semble ne plus fonctionner";
} elseif (count($redirect) == 1) {
$reason .= ' car sa redirection vers ' . $redirect[0] . ' est hors-service depuis plusiers mois.';
} else {
- $reason .= ' car ses redirections vers ' . implode(', ', $redirect)
+ $reason .= ' car ses redirections vers ' . implode(', ', $redirect)
. ' sont hors-services depuis plusieurs mois.';
}
}
. "-- \nTrès Cordialement,\nL'Equipe de Polytechnique.org\n";
$body = wordwrap($body, 78);
$mailer = new PlMailer();
- $mailer->setFrom('"Association Polytechnique.org" <register@' . $globals->mails->domain . '>');
+ $mailer->setFrom('"Association Polytechnique.org" <register@' . $globals->mail->domain . '>');
$mailer->addTo($this->m_email);
$mailer->setSubject($subject);
$mailer->setTxtBody($body);